Dan Lyman is an American journalist known for his involvement in conspiracy theories and association with controversial media figures. Lyman has garnered attention for his work that often aligns with far-right ideologies, frequently appearing on platforms that promote conspiracy theories. His work includes contributing to discussions on various unfounded and debunked conspiracies, which has led to significant debate and criticism.

Lyman's career became more prominent through his business connections with Alex Jones. Lyman has written for infowars.com and has made multiple appearances on Jones's platforms where he has discussed topics ranging from anti-globalization to immigration, often framing them in apocalyptic and conspiratorial terms. This association has raised questions about the legitimacy and motivations behind his journalism.
